Agente IHostHealth

public interface IHostHealthAgent

com.android.tradefed.util.hostmetric.IHostHealthAgent


Uma interface para emitir métricas de host ou dispositivo.

Resumo

Métodos públicos

abstract void emitValue (String name, long value, data) emitValue (String name, long value, data)

Emite um valor para um nome de métrica.

abstract void flush ()

Libera métricas enfileiradas.

Métodos públicos

emitirValor

public abstract void emitValue (String name, 
                long value, 
                 data)

Emite um valor para um nome de métrica. O valor é enfileirado e carregado quando IHostHealthAgent#flush é chamado.

Parâmetros
name String : um nome de métrica

value long : um valor métrico

data : dados associados ao valor da métrica

rubor

public abstract void flush ()

Libera métricas enfileiradas.